Komsic warned: The Declaration of the All-Serbian Parliament defined the Targets and Platform for a new Conflict

Published June 11, 2024
Share
SHARE

BiH Presidency member Željko Komšić says that the All-Serbian Parliament has defined targets and a political-religious platform that is preparing it for a new conflict.

“The declaration represents an improved and more adapted, in accordance with the current geopolitical situation, political-religious platform that should serve as a basis for gathering and preparing for a new conflict,” he warned.

Komšić believes that with this declaration “targets are defined” as well as the method of preparation.

“There are especially aggressive provisions related to Kosovo, Bosnia and Herzegovina and Montenegro. Any underestimation of this platform is extremely dangerous. In the same way, the meaning of the SANU Memorandum was underestimated, and we all know what it led to,” he said.

Komšić points out that the creators of the declaration are ready to wait for years, until some new geopolitical circumstances allow them to start the violent implementation of the project, dating back to the era of Ilija Garašanin, the Greater Serbia project, Klix.ba writes.
